Output 51e34fa6eb8c5fe0ef18dc89391d9585a79678e3e3d32f3b99ac104b8e6a2b4a:1

value
193501000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b44fbb8245e4a6676dc35efc70069c67f25ab9 OP_EQUAL
address
MKiyQSEQAWapdPBKQTmnZpNCJWn9ZAaaQA
transaction
51e34fa6eb8c5fe0ef18dc89391d9585a79678e3e3d32f3b99ac104b8e6a2b4a
spent
true